Start Here: Introduction to the Early World (with Jeff Cavins)

Jeff Cavins, a Catholic Bible teacher and creator of the Great Adventure Bible Timeline, joins Fr. Mike Schmitz to kickstart a journey through Scripture. They explore the Early World period, emphasizing the unique poetic structure of Genesis 1-11 and its significance for modern readers. Cavins discusses the creation pattern, the fall of humanity, and the implications of sin on relationships. They also delve into the flood narrative as a pivotal moment in salvation history, highlighting hope amid brokenness.

Day 1: In the Beginning (2026)

Embark on a profound exploration of creation as Fr. Mike Schmitz dives into Genesis 1-2 and Psalm 19. Discover the poetic beauty behind God's creation and humanity's unique dignity. The discussion highlights Eve's role as a helper and the mutual respect in relationships. Fr. Mike contrasts Genesis with other creation myths, emphasizing a narrative of goodness rather than chaos. Unpack the significance of labor, love, and Sabbath, while reflecting on the original innocence in human nature. A journey of faith and understanding awaits!

BONUS: How to Hear God's Voice in Scripture

Fr. Mike shares five insightful tips to help listeners hear God's voice in Scripture. He emphasizes understanding the different literary forms in the Bible and the significance of human authorship melded with divine inspiration. The discussion touches on interpretive principles from the Catechism and explains the various senses of Scripture, including literal and spiritual meanings. Readers are encouraged to approach Scripture with humility, trust, and persistence, even through challenging passages.
